Gr 6 Up—Laetitia, a young Blackfoot woman living north of the Canadian border, moves to Salt Lake City after growing bored with her life, which is filled with tension between her and her mother. After some time has passed, Laetitia's mother and her little brother, who narrates the story, decide to take a road trip to visit, and so must pass through two border checkpoints: one for the United States and one for Canada. At each checkpoint, Laetitia's mother is asked her citizenship, and at each, she claims her Blackfoot nationality.
